This is the old Karnes Orchard in the foreground and is still owned and run by the Karnes family, the orchard looks much different today with modern growing techniques now being used for the apple trees. The Karnes's still own the barn on the left side of the photo and it's still there, though the surrounding sheds are gone.
The farm on the far side of the road was owned by Mary Ross and was passed on to one of her daughters after her death. The house is hidden in the trees but is still there and has been well maintained. The barn on the right is still there as well and is part of the Ross farm, though was repaired in the early 2000's after it partially collapsed during a possible tornado. The field in the background is also part of the farm and is still used to grow mainly corn and soybeans, but occasionally wheat also.
The only other thing of note is that the road doesn't appear to be paved in this photo, but it may have been as I was too young at this time to remember. I'm surprise at how little has changed overall.
